Clifton police are warning residents about an increase in home invasions and burglaries after two more homes in the area were targeted.
Police say that early Friday morning, a group of suspects tried to force open the bathroom window of a home on Friar Lane but were unsuccessful.
Police say that two nights later at a home on nearby Conklin Drive, suspects were able to enter a home through an unlocked bathroom window. They ran off after the homeowner woke up and noticed them. They were able to get away with some jewelry and other items.
No arrests have been made.
